Well I have been very busy with uni and work over the last few weeks so I think it;s time for a fishing/boating update :cheer:

Well around a month ago fishing the pin with stinkyibis, we hit up the usual spots of weedbeds, sand bars and drop offs. Not a bad days fishing with a lot of small bream and some larger ones to 29c(fork) all on plastics and blades. I got a large flahead on a sx40 measuring 68cm. Quite lucky to land him on 6lb fluoro whe he swallowed the small lure down his gob.

That same day working along a rock wall I got my PB bream on a SP measuring just over 30cm to the fork. Not a huge fish but put up a solid fight on 4lb FC rock.

I also did some work to the boat. Got a new stainless prop and finally got the bow modified with a mounting plate for the watersnake leccy. She's all good to go now, wiring is neat and tidy.

It's a 2006 2str yamaha 30hp-CV. Not entirely sure about what the CV part is possibly just a model?

My girlfriends brother is an apprentice marine technician or something and his boss asked if I could trial the new prop for him. So I haven't bought it yet but we'll see how it performs. It's no bigger then the original but the stainless is a stronger metal then the original so apparently it'll have better handling a little more speed.
